Reserve Bank of New Zealand Workshop held on 27 April 2004
This workshop aims to generate discussion around how banks operate and compete with one another, how to think about ways in which economic shocks might affect banks, and how regulators can deal with banks that are under stress.
The participants at the workshop come from a variety of backgrounds and institutions: members of academia, of the banking and financial services industries, and of policy institutions will be involved in the discussion at the workshop. The presentations at this workshop will cover a mixture of conceptual and empirical work in these areas, and will address recent thinking on some of these issues as well as discussing New Zealand's recent experience of "stress-testing" banks.
